Helen SLATER Obituary

On 15th May 2024. Late of Woodlands Palmerston North, formerly Nepia Road, Wanganui. Dearly loved wife of the late Basil. Most treasured and loved Mum of Kirk and Judy Slater (Wanganui), Cecilia and John Yiannoutsos (Palmerston North), Sherab Palmo and Joe Geldard (Auckland), Todd Slater and Bonni Cooke (Christchurch). Loved Nana of 10 grandchildren and Great Nana Helen of 9 great grandchildren. Loved and adored sister and sister-in-law of (the late) John and Sue Prince, the late Percy and Betty Slater, Ione and (the late) John Haines, Colleen and (the late) Brian Slater, and their families. In memory of Helen donations to the Wanganui St John Ambulance Service would be appreciated. A service to celebrate Helen's life will be held in the Cleveland Chapel, 179 Ingestre Street, Wanganui, on Tuesday 21st May 2024 at 10.00am, and will be live-streamed at www.clevelandfunerals.co.nz.


Published by Manawatu Standard from May 18 to May 20, 2024.
